High-Aridity & Desert Environments

Desert solar farms face harsh operating conditions like dust layering and extreme thermal expansion. Here, Single Axis Tracker systems coupled with 40-foot adjustable solar cleaning brush kits maintain yield. Additionally, Module-Level Power Electronics (MLPE) prevent thermal runaway and eliminate hot spot risks.

AI-Powered Maximum Power Point Tracking (MPPT)

Legacy systems suffer massive generation drops when shadow profiles cover individual solar cells. By introducing smart PV optimizers (such as our Huawei Smart Optimizers and PV Optimizers with Rapid Shutdown), arrays adapt automatically. They optimize string voltage levels continuously to harvest maximum power even under variable shading profiles.

Why are double-drive trackers preferred for C&I applications?
Double-drive single-axis tracker controllers distribute rotational torque evenly across structural frames. This design protects the racking assembly during high wind gusts, reduces static twist risks, and prevents structural failure. It ensures secure tracking operations even under heavy environmental loads.
How do smart PV optimizers avoid localized hot spots?
When a single solar cell gets shaded by dust or debris, it changes from a power producer to a power consumer, creating resistive heat (hot spots). Smart optimizers (like our Tigo and Huawei models) use Module-Level Power Electronics (MLPE) to isolate shaded modules. By adjusting current and voltage levels dynamically, they bypass the affected cell, protecting the PV array and maintaining maximum energy output.
What certifications are necessary for global PV cable installations?
Global regulatory bodies require specialized certifications for high-voltage DC equipment. Our PV cables carry TUV and UL approvals, confirming they meet EN 50618 (H1Z2Z2-K) standards. These tinned-copper conductors features halogen-free XLPE insulation, providing excellent resistance against UV, ozone, moisture, and extreme temperatures.
